I already mentioned how Shadowbet Casino has chosen to travel a path where not many have gone before or after. What I was referring to were Shadowbet’s rich gamification effects. At this casino, every bet that you make will go into racking up some experience points. These points, in turn, can earn you new levels and rewards along the way. Cue in the ominous Ouroboros wheel!
With the Ouroboros wheel, players at Shadowbet can win some great prices every time that they level up. There are free spins, deposit bonuses, real money, and even jackpots on offer here.
In addition to the neat gamification features at Shadowbet, I should also include the great games selection as well as the very practical search feature. Here you can easily find lots of games from Microgaming, NetEnt, Play’n GO, NYX, Betsoft, and Quickspin.

The casino slot that I am going to introduce to you this time is Koi Princess. This NetEnt classic was one of the first games of its kind to make use of the so-called bonus bet function. By bolstering up your bet level here, you can increase the frequency with which the free spins mode will be triggered. Instead of betting more than you want, though, you can just lower your usual bet level and then double it with the bonus bet function.
Koi Princess has a wealth of random features to its name. When you get 3 scatters on your screen, you will get to spin a wheel to determine what kind of a bonus game you will get. Just remember to cross your fingers so that you will not hit the anticlimactic coin win instead!
